Requirements At least 5 years of experience developing and maintaining native iOS apps Expert-level knowledge of Swift, Objective-C, & iOS SDK Experience with SwiftUI for building modern user interfaces Solid understanding of clean architecture, design patterns (MVVM) and principles Solid understanding of parallel programming (including async/await More ❯
Stockport, Greater Manchester, North West, United Kingdom Hybrid / WFH Options
Profile 29
Requirements At least 5 years of experience developing and maintaining native iOS apps Expert-level knowledge of Swift, Objective-C, & iOS SDK Experience with SwiftUI for building modern user interfaces Solid understanding of clean architecture, design patterns (MVVM) and principles Solid understanding of parallel programming (including async/await More ❯
oriented design Professional experience with mobile development in iOS 3+ years of experience in modern iOS development tools and principles such as Swift, MVVM, SwiftUI, ReactiveSwift, Combine, Alamofire, CoreBluetooth, SwiftGen, SwiftLint, and Instruments. PREFERRED QUALIFICATIONS Experience with object-oriented development, multithreading, and data structures Experience contributing to the architecture More ❯
goals. Essential skills: Extensive experience in Swift/iOS and XCTest Experience building mobile app frameworks, Cocoapods and SPM Experience using both UIKit and SwiftUI Accessibility best practice Continuous Integration/Continuous Delivery TDD, pair programming Agile development methods such as Scrum or Kanban REST API development and/ More ❯
apps, with a strong focus on iOS (Swift). Android experience is a plus. Deep understanding of MVVM, MVP, and reactive software architectures (e.g., SwiftUI, Jetpack Compose). Proven track record of influencing engineering decisions in a complex environment. Strong knowledge of Agile methodologies, Continuous Integration, and Continuous Delivery. More ❯
Team Mentorship: Contribute to the team growth through hiring and mentoring new team members Desirable Experience In: Native mobile app development in iOS Swift, SwiftUI, and UIKit for iOS development Building hybrid applications with technologies such as React Native, Flutter, PWA Architectural patterns (MVC, MVVM, SOLID) and best practices More ❯
3+ years of experience developing native iOS applications with Swift. Strong understanding of Object-Oriented Programming (OOP), SOLID principles, and design patterns. Expertise in SwiftUI, UIKit, Foundation, structured concurrency, and dependency injection. A deep understanding of iOS best practices and the ability to influence framework and tool selections. Benefits More ❯
a plus. Solid understanding of the full mobile development lifecycle. Strong knowledge of clean architecture, MVVM, SOLID principles, and software design patterns. Experience with SwiftUI and UIKit for building modern, responsive UI. Familiarity with iOS frameworks such as Core Data, Core Animation, and Core Location. Experience with OAuth 2.0 More ❯
a successful conclusion and the ability to influence at all levels. You’ll also need experience in iOS development with excellent understanding of UIKit, SwiftUI and Swift. You’ll also bring: Good knowledge of technical architecture and the functionality of applications used to support the business Experience of working More ❯
3+ years of experience developing native iOS applications with Swift. Strong understanding of Object-Oriented Programming (OOP), SOLID principles, and design patterns. Expertise in SwiftUI, UIKit, Foundation, structured concurrency, and dependency injection. A deep understanding of iOS best practices and the ability to influence framework and tool selections. Benefits More ❯
Product Mindset: Demonstrated ability to understand product goals and translate them into technical solutions that resonate with users. Technical Expertise: Advanced proficiency with Swift, SwiftUI, UIKit, and familiarity with MVVM or other architectural patterns in iOS. Collaborative Skills: Proven experience working in cross-functional teams with product managers, designers More ❯
you to hear what makes you great for this role. What we'd like to see from you: Strong knowledge of iOS, Swift, UIKit, SwiftUI and related SDKs Experience in clean architectures (MVVM-C) Exposure to Continuous Integration systems Experience in writing Unit Tests (XCTest) Experience of multi-threading More ❯
tasks and processes. To be successful in this role, you will need to be: An experienced iOS developer for technology companies. Knowledgeable in Swift, SwiftUI, libraries, frameworks, and tech stacks. A detail-oriented person, especially in identifying and fixing errors. A proactive and confident communicator. A collaborative team player More ❯
and tools Our frontend is built with VueJS and TypeScript. On the backend we mainly use NodeJS. On mobile we use native iOS (Swift, SwiftUI and UIKit) and native Android (Kotlin and Jetpack Compose) with a shared layer of KMP. Other core technologies include AWS, Express, Vite, Webpack, NPM More ❯
iOS frameworks, design patterns, and best practices. Proven experience in architecting, developing, and releasing complex iOS features. Experience building flexible and reusable UI with SwiftUI and UIKit, and ideally maintaining interoperability between the two. Experience working with RESTful APIs and integrating third-party SDKs. Excellent communication and collaboration abilities. More ❯
Manchester, North West, United Kingdom Hybrid / WFH Options
Redline Group Ltd
a seamless user experience. The successful candidate for this iOS Developer position in Manchester will possess: Professional experience in iOS development using Swift and SwiftUI/UIKit. Expertise in Xcode, iOS SDK, and related tools. Strong understanding of iOS architecture and its interaction with connected devices. To apply for More ❯
SageMaker, Vert.x, LangChain, Large Language Models, Prompt Engineering, DialogFlow, Python. Experience with at least one of the following: Front-end technologies like React, Angular, SwiftUI (iOS), Kotlin (Android). Back-end technologies like Java, Typescript, Spring, Express (NodeJS). Prior working experience in a cloud computing environment like AWS More ❯
SageMaker, Vert.x, LangChain, Large Language Models, Prompt Engineering, DialogFlow, Python. Experience with at least one of the following: Front-end technologies like React, Angular, SwiftUI (iOS), Kotlin (Android) or Back-end technologies like Java, Typescript, Spring, Express (NodeJS). Prior working experience in a cloud computing environment like AWS More ❯
SnapKit - as our auto layout DSL, though we have an in-house framework built on top of SnapKit which allows us to write declarative, SwiftUI like layout code for UIKit. Realm - as the application main persistence layer; Sourcery and SwiftGen - for various code generation tasks. SwiftFormat, SwiftLint and Danger More ❯
SnapKit - as our auto layout DSL, though we have an in-house framework built on top of SnapKit which allows us to write declarative, SwiftUI like layout code for UIKit. Realm - as the application main persistence layer; Sourcery and SwiftGen - for various code generation tasks. SwiftFormat, SwiftLint and Danger More ❯
platforms, namely iOS (Swift/Objective-C), Android (Kotlin/Java), and cross-platform frameworks (React Native/Flutter) leveraging several UI toolkits (UIKit, SwiftUI, Android view, Jetpack Compose). You will participate in the design, implementation, and optimization of high-performance Contentsquare SDK applications, working within a dynamic … Native/Flutter). Experience with applications published on App Store and Play Store. Strong knowledge of mobile architecture patterns and UI toolkits (UIKit, SwiftUI, Android view, Jetpack Compose). Proven experience with API integration, asynchronous programming, and offline-first applications. Familiarity with mobile DevOps practices, including CI/ More ❯
growth and skill development of less experienced team members Requirements: At least 5 years of commercial experience in iOS development Strong proficiency in Swift, SwiftUI, and Swift Concurrency Strong skills in task planning and timely delivery Nice-to-haves: Background in external communication or contributions to open-source projects More ❯
london, south east england, united kingdom Hybrid / WFH Options
Flipper Devices Inc
growth and skill development of less experienced team members Requirements: At least 5 years of commercial experience in iOS development Strong proficiency in Swift, SwiftUI, and Swift Concurrency Strong skills in task planning and timely delivery Nice-to-haves: Background in external communication or contributions to open-source projects More ❯
their mission is to help you develop and grow as an engineer. Our app is 100% Swift and our latest features are built in SwiftUI and using elements of The Composable Architecture. Historically, we built using a Model, View, View-Model architecture (MVVM). We use Coordinators to ensure More ❯